Who would authorise a qualifying cross country flight with a taf and actual as follows?
TAF EGxx 1322 23015g30KT 7000 SHRA BKN020CB TEMPO 1322
3000 TS BKN010CB PROB40 1317 TSRA BKN10CB
METAR 1350 EGxx 22020g31kt 7000 BKN010CB 15/11 Q1015.
Well someone did, I won't name them, although I should do, the club was from a very well known organisation, south of Ipswich, which operates off grass runways.
I could see on radar that the students elected route, and al around him for 40 miles, heavy weather and thunderstorm activity was present, and I advised him of such.
The student did very well, but departed in similar weather, seemingly oblivious to the consequences.
All I can say to his authorising instructer is shame on you.:mad:
